Inventory Associate
MQUEEN TRADERS PRIVATE LIMITED · Kendujhar
Job description
About the role
The Inventory Associate is a full‑time, on‑site position based in Kendujhar. You will be responsible for managing inventory levels, tracking stock movements, and maintaining accurate records while providing excellent service to customers.
Key responsibilities
- Maintain up‑to‑date inventory records and monitor stock levels.
- Conduct regular inventory audits to ensure accuracy.
- Collaborate with purchasing and sales teams for stock forecasting.
- Ensure efficient handling, storage, and movement of goods.
- Address customer queries related to inventory and provide timely assistance.
Required profile
- Proficiency in inventory management, tracking, stock control, and reporting.
- Strong communication and customer‑service abilities.
- High attention to detail and strong organizational skills.
- Basic computer literacy and familiarity with inventory management software.
- Ability to work both independently and as part of a team.
- Prior experience in retail inventory management or a related field is preferred.
Required skills
- Inventory tracking and control practices.
- Stock reporting and audit procedures.
- Basic computer skills and use of inventory management tools.
